ぴゅう太の拡張スロットにRAM&ROMカートリッジをつないでみる その2

ぴゅう太の拡張スロットに、32KB RAM(CXK58257P-10L) と 32KB ROM(27C256)をつなぐRAM & ROMカートリッジを開発しました。

http://www.geocities.jp/parallel_computer_inc/cart.html

GALを書き換えることで、8KB/16KB/24KB/32KBのROMが実行できます。

http://d.hatena.ne.jp/tanam/20170325/1490446341

f:id:tanam:20170327065850j:image:w360

Address  A0 A1 A2 SELEXM| /CE  RAM  /CE2 A14 A13 ROM
>0000    0  0  0  0     |  1         1   -   -
>2000    0  0  1  0     |  1         1   -   -
>4000    0  1  0  1     |  0  >4000  1   -   -
>6000    0  1  1  1     |  0  >6000  1   -   -
>8000    1  0  0  1     |  1         0   0   0  >0000
>A000    1  0  1  1     |  1         0   0   1  >2000
>C000    1  1  0  1     |  1         0   1   0  >4000
>E000    1  1  1  0     |  1         1   -   -

ぴゅう太JrではSELEXMがないため32KB ROMカートリッジとして使います。

http://www43.tok2.com/home/cmpslv/PyuutaJR/EnrPtj.htm

27C512なのでジャンパーで32KB ROMが2つ切り替えられます。

http://d.hatena.ne.jp/tanam/20170309/1489056568

f:id:tanam:20170327065930j:image:w360

Address  A0 A1 A2 SELEXM| /CE  RAM  /CE2 A14 A13 ROM
>0000    0  0  0  0     |  1         1   -   -
>2000    0  0  1  0     |  1         1   -   -
>4000    0  1  0  1     |  1         0   0   0  >0000
>6000    0  1  1  1     |  1         0   0   0  >2000
>8000    1  0  0  1     |  1         0   0   1  >4000
>A000    1  0  1  1     |  1         0   1   0  >6000
>C000    1  1  0  1     |  1         1   -   -
>E000    1  1  1  0     |  1         1   -   -